Why Is Glasses So Expensive: The Lens of Truth
Stepping into an optical store can often feel like entering a high-end boutique. You might be surprised by the price tags attached to seemingly simple frames and lenses. But why do glasses so expensive? It's not just about the ingredients used; it's a complex blend of factors that contribute to the final cost.
- In fact, the technology behind modern lenses is incredibly sophisticated. Lenses aren't just simple glass slabs anymore; they can be crafted to correct a wide range of acuity problems, from nearsightedness to astigmatism. These unique lenses require precise manufacturing processes and specialized machinery.
- Furthermore, the cost of materials plays a significant role. Lenses are often made from polycarbonate, trivex or even composite materials. The quality and type of material directly impact the lens's durability.
- Also, frame design and components also contribute to the overall cost. Frames can be crafted from various metals, plastics and often involve intricate designs.
